ABOUT US

Jupiter is the global market leader in analytics for resilience planning and enterprise climate risk management. We are led by pioneers in data, climate, and earth and ocean sciences, as well as technology, risk management, company building, and public policy. Our climate risk modeling solutions save lives and mitigate potentially catastrophic impacts inflicted by hurricanes, floods, heat waves, wildfires, drought, and other extreme weather events on homes, businesses, infrastructure, food and water supplies, and entire economies.

As a Sales Development Specialist at Jupiter Intelligence, you will play a crucial role in driving our sales pipeline and revenue growth. You will be responsible for identifying and qualifying potential leads, engaging with prospects, and setting appointments. The ideal candidate is proactive, results-oriented, and possesses excellent communication and interpersonal skills.
